Incandescent bulbs produce other forms of energy, too, including heat.
Explanation: Incandescent bulbs waste a lot of the electrical energy as heat; compact fluorescent bulbs convert a larger fraction of the input energy into visible light, so they give the same light output while using less electrical power.
